Understanding the Core Issues

To really understand what's going on, we have to look at the root causes of the conflict. The India-Pakistan relationship is based on several key factors. Historical baggage is a huge one, as both countries share a complex and often violent past. The Partition of India in 1947, which led to the creation of Pakistan, left deep scars and unresolved issues. Then there's the Kashmir dispute, which we already mentioned. Both countries claim the region, leading to decades of fighting. Also, nationalism and identity play a huge role. Both India and Pakistan have strong national identities, and any perceived threat to these identities can cause tensions to rise. Finally, external influences can't be ignored. The involvement of other countries, such as China and the United States, can affect the dynamics between India and Pakistan. It's a complex interplay of historical, political, and strategic elements, and there aren't any easy answers. The Kashmir Dispute: A Deep Dive

The Kashmir dispute is the heart of the India-Pakistan conflict. It's a territorial dispute that dates back to the Partition of India in 1947. Both India and Pakistan claim the entire region of Kashmir, but each controls a portion of it. The Line of Control (LoC) divides the region, and it's a heavily militarized border. The dispute has led to several wars and numerous skirmishes between the two countries. The situation in Kashmir is complex, with a long history of conflict. There are various armed groups fighting against Indian rule, and human rights violations have been reported. The situation has also had a significant impact on the lives of people living in the region, with constant threats of violence. Finding a solution to the Kashmir dispute is essential for lasting peace between India and Pakistan, but it's a challenging task.
